Beryllium chloride is an inorganic compound with the formula BeCl2. It is a colourless, hygroscopic solid that dissolves well in many polar solvents..
Also question is, can BeCl2 dissolve in water?
Beryllium chloride is stable in dry air, but absorbs moisture forming its tetrahydrate, BeCl2•4H2O. It readily dissolves in water undergoing hydrolysis and evolving hydrochloric acid.
Secondly, what is the structure of BeCl2? In the solid state, BeCl2 has polymeric chain structure. Be atom is tetrahedrally surrounded by four Cl atoms - two are bonded by covalent bonds while the other two by coordinate bonds. The polymeric structure of BeCl2 is due to its electron deficient nature.

Why is BeCl2 a simple covalent molecule?
Due to small size and high charge density Be, its polarizing power is maximum, since Be+2 ion essentially pull the electrons cloud from Cl- , such that the electrons pair are effectively shared. This give covalent character to BeCl2.

Beryllium chloride reacts vigorously and exothermically with water, evolving hydrogen chloride gas. This is typical of covalent chlorides. Initially, BeCl2 reacts to form hydrated beryllium ions, [Be(H2O)4]2+, and chloride ions. These hydrated beryllium ions (named as tetraaquaberyllium) are strongly acidic.Why is BeCl2 soluble in organic solvent?

Beryllium chloride, BeCl2, melts at 405°C and boils at 520°C. That compares with 714°C and 1412°C for magnesium chloride. Notice how much dramatically lower the boiling point of beryllium chloride is compared with magnesium chloride.Is beryllium a metal?

In the gaseous phase, beryllium chloride exists in equilibrium as two compounds; the linear BeCl2 (which is sp hybridized, as previously mentioned) and a dimerized form; (BeCl2)2, where each beryllium is bound to three chlorines, which requires that the hybridization is sp2.How many grams of beryllium chloride would you need to add to 125ml?
